The bitterness of not getting a political appointments reflects in his comment on the bond transaction which shows his lack of knowledge or lack of professionalism. It is instructive to note that norms for bond issuance is not only the responsibility of security and exchange commission.

Private bonds are legal, which explains why more than 10 states have sought for solution to their pressing needs in the capital market (Ekiti, Ondo, Ogun, Oyo, Edo, Plateau, Cross River, Sokoto, Adamawa, even Kwara during the tenure of Bukola Saraki). Also, if it's not legal, DMO, SEC, federal ministry of finance, etc, will not give approval to invest in it.

Also, on the Offa Grammar School raised by the writer, Offa community reached out to the government and requested that the approval given for the comprehensive renovation of the Offa Grammer School, one of the oldest schools in their community should be reviewed.

The community thereafter proposed that four other schools from within their community should undergo partial renovation.

The reasoning behind this was that a prominent daughter of Offa, Mrs Sarah Alade, had used her influence to get some NGOs to renovate OGS, It is normal and reasonable to assume that the writer is not grounded in Offa or kwara politics.
